Linitis plastica infiltrating the entire gut

A case of extensive spread of linitis plastica, involving the entire gastrointestinal tract, is reported. The tumor probably originated in the stomach. Because the mucosal and serosal layers remained intact, diagnosis was markedly delayed, as is commonly seen in scirrhous carcinoma. The method of spread of the tumor (mainly through the submucosal layer) is unusual, and is probably related to the histological type of carcinoma.
